The airline will take delivery of the aircraft in April 2001. Hamburg International Airlines currently operates a fleet of two Boeing 737-700 aircraft for passenger charter services under contract from German tour operators. In addition to domestic routes, the airline services flights to various Mediterranean resort locations from smaller German cities such as Lubeck and Saarbrucken. Hamburg International, established in 1998, is a privately held independent airline. "CIT Aerospace is excited to welcome Hamburg International Airlines as one of its customers," said C. Jeffrey Knittel, President, CIT Aerospace. "The airline is a dynamic representative of the growing charter business in Germany and in Europe as a whole." "We look forward to receiving our next B737-700 from CIT to accommodate the business requirements of our customers," said Christoph von Saldern, Managing Director, Hamburg International. "We chose CIT for their reputation and years of experience in the aerospace industry."
